51ak.blogs

随笔分类 -  Mysql

从零写一个兼容MySQL/Oracle的Proxy中件间(一)《初识Oracle的通信协议》
摘要:0.前言 MySQL由于开源的原因,有各式各样的中件间Proxy ,极大的丰富了做高可用或迁移的方案,习惯了MySQL生态圈的灵活和便利,Oracle官方不开源代码和协议,没有中间件proxy,显得很笨重。 比如以下的方案就会很不好办: 实时抓取Oralce的访问SQL日志 慢日志捕获和收集 高可用 阅读全文

posted @ 2023-02-01 10:07 51ak 阅读(243) 评论(0) 推荐(0) 编辑

51ak带你看MYSQL5.7源码4:实现SQL黑名单功能
摘要:博客迁移至: https://www.dboop.com/ 从事DBA工作多年 MYSQL源码也是头一次接触 尝试记录下自己看MYSQL5.7源码的历程 申明:个人Python编程很溜,但是C++还停在白痴水平,源码理解方面有点弱,如发现有错误的地方,轻喷。 博客的题目是看源码,实际上可能会发现在不 阅读全文

posted @ 2018-04-11 19:46 51ak 阅读(870) 评论(0) 推荐(0) 编辑

51ak带你看MYSQL5.7源码3:修改代码实现你的第一个Mysql版本
摘要:经过开发和测试环境部署 现在到了我们动手的时候了,万事开头难,首先我们实现个小功能 今天我们准备实现这样一个功能:数据永远也不会被DELETE掉 阅读全文

posted @ 2018-03-23 14:29 51ak 阅读(1530) 评论(0) 推荐(1) 编辑

51ak带你看MYSQL5.7源码2:编译现有的代码
摘要:从事DBA工作多年 MYSQL源码也是头一次接触 尝试记录下自己看MYSQL5.7源码的历程 申明:个人Python编程很溜,但是C++还停在白痴水平,源码理解方面有点弱,如发现有错误的地方,轻喷 目录: 51ak带你看MYSQL5.7源码1:main入口函数 (2018-03-21) 51ak带你 阅读全文

posted @ 2018-03-22 18:43 51ak 阅读(649) 评论(0) 推荐(0) 编辑

51ak带你看MYSQL5.7源码1:main入口函数
摘要:尝试一点点的记录下 自己看MYSQL源码的历程 51ak带你看MYSQL源码1:main入口函数 阅读全文

posted @ 2018-03-22 16:12 51ak 阅读(2749) 评论(0) 推荐(0) 编辑

Mysql使用规范文档 20180223版
摘要:强制:不允许在跳板机上/生产服务器上手工连接,查询或更改线上数据。 强制:所有上线脚本必须先在测试环境执行,验证通过以后方可在生产环境执行。 强制:上线脚本的编码格式统一为UTF-8。 强制:访问数据库需要使用DNS域名,不能直接写IP。 阅读全文

posted @ 2018-02-23 17:46 51ak 阅读(232) 评论(0) 推荐(0) 编辑

Mysql5.7动态修改innodb_buffer_pool_size
摘要:SELECT @@innodb_buffer_pool_size,@@innodb_buffer_pool_chunk_size,@@innodb_buffer_pool_instances; SET GLOBAL innodb_buffer_pool_size=92341796864; SHOW 阅读全文

posted @ 2017-12-27 14:41 51ak 阅读(382) 评论(0) 推荐(0) 编辑

搭建一套完整的Mysql5.7innodbcluster(GroupReplication+mysqlrouter)
摘要:搭Mysql5.7 Group Replication ,配置成单主模式 安装Mysqlshell,配innodbcluster 安装Mysql-router 阅读全文

posted @ 2017-12-23 22:05 51ak 阅读(365) 评论(0) 推荐(0) 编辑

导航

统计

点击右上角即可分享
微信分享提示